There are lots of ducks on several of the refuges in Northwest TN. I hunted about 2 miles from a refuge for the last 4 days and did pretty well. We would go an hour or so without seeing a duck then we would have 100-300 just show up out of nowhere. I suppose they just get up and stretch their wings a time or two a day. Ultimately you would get one good volley out of all of them and they would go back to where they came from. I image they will get up to check out the fresh water in the fields if we get any substantial rain this weekend.
